With a B-17 bomber as their clubhouse, these four friends use their detective skills to solve strange cases in the badlands of Arizona. Based on the popular LCD video series, these all-new shows blend exciting action, faith-building stories and a twist of mystery.

LCD features movie-quality sound design and a talented cast, including Daryl Sabara from Spy Kids and June Lockhart of "Lassie" and "Lost in Space."

"Last Flight of the Dragon Lady"
Audio Case #3

Listen to an audio clip

Terror at 2,000 Feet
A lab explosion. A strange message. And a final request from an old friend. It’s all part of a mysterious adventure when the Last Chance Detectives join Pop as he pilots a DC-3 to Pensacola. They have no idea that hidden on the plane is some hot cargo, and sinister forces will stop at nothing to terminate their flight! The real terror begins when Pop slumps over at the controls. With the radio sabotaged and the fuel gauge on empty, it’s up to Mike and his friends to somehow bring the plane down safely.
